City of Philadelphia
Public Hearing Notice
October 11, 2007
The Committee on Public Safety of the Council of the City of Philadelphia will
hold a Public Hearing Wednesday, October 17, 2007, at 1:00 PM, in Room 400, City
Hall, to hear testimony on the following items:
070275 An Ordinance amending Title 6 of The Philadelphia Code, entitled "Health
Code," by adopting certain provisions of the National Fire Protection
Association Standard on Fire Department Occupational Safety and Health Program,
NFPA 1500, related to hearing protection measures for Firefighters and
Paramedics, with amendments thereto, all under certain terms and conditions.
070025 Resolution authorizing City Council's Committee on Public Safety to hold
public hearings to examine and evaluate the feasibility of equipping emergency
call centers with "Incident Linked Multimedia" (Camera Cell Phone) type response
systems, and the crime fighting and security benefits they offer; in addition,
to determine the resources and planning required to enable the emergency call
centers, crisis response teams and citizens of our City to take advantage of
this technology.
070330 Resolution remembering, Memorializing, Honoring, and Mourning the 32
people slain at Virginia Tech on April 16, 2007, and authorizing City Council's
Committee on Public Safety to hold public hearings to investigate how safe the
College Campuses in The City of Philadelphia are; and, in furtherance of such
investigation, authorizing the issuance of subpoenas to compel the attendance of
witnesses and the production of documents to the full extent authorized under
Section 2-401 of the Home Rule Charter.
Immediately following the public hearing, a meeting of the Committee on Public
Safety, open to the public, will be held to consider the action to be taken on
the above listed items.
Copies of the foregoing items are available in the Office of the Chief Clerk of
the Council, Room 402, City Hall.
